Transaction 588fee0778fd6964a4af31c9b37169a3d2fb33a317c562c319b2add67c337832
1 Input
1 Output
-
588fee0778fd6964a4af31c9b37169a3d2fb33a317c562c319b2add67c337832:0
- value
- 11890704
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ea554c8de998de5ce714ef25f133dd5d6242ef6f OP_EQUAL
- address
- 3P44E7XQ9zj1QSuSttKRztY7aZQRaL9iCC